CNC Milling Machines
Used for precision-cut parts, slots, pockets, contours, brackets, plates, housings, and custom components.
CNC Turning Machines
Used for round parts such as shafts, bushings, pins, spacers, shoulders, grooves, and threaded components.
Manual Machining Equipment
Used for repair parts, modifications, fit adjustments, and one-off components when a manual setup is the best match.
Inspection Equipment
Used to verify critical dimensions and drawing requirements during and after machining for consistent outcomes.
Shop Support Equipment
Used for stock prep, deburring, surface prep, and workflow steps that keep parts moving efficiently through the shop.
Tooling & Fixtures
Used to improve part location and repeatability, reduce setup variability, and support consistent machining.
CNC Lathes
- Supermax YMC-TM-15
- Daewoo Puma 2500LSY
- Super Kia Turn 21L
- Citizen Cincom A20 VIPL
- (2) Miyano LZ-01
CNC Mills
- Doosan DNM 5700 (4-Axis)
- Daewoo DMV 4020 (4-Axis)
- Daewoo DMV 3016
- Supermax FV-56A
- Ares Seiki S3030 Twin Pallet
- Kia KV25P Twin Pallet
- Kia HIV50D Twin Pallet
Manual Machines
- Le-Blonde Regal Lathe: 19" Swing/102" Centers
- Le-Blonde Large M1980: 17.3" Swing/54" Centers
- Davidson Lathe M1788: 17" Swing/33" Centers
- Warner-Swasey #4 M1420 Turret Lathe
- Mazak Lathe M1968 (Hurcules/AJAX): 36" Swing/100" Centers
- Southbend M500 Horizontal Lathe: 24" Swing/96" Centers
- Bridgeport Dual Head Miller with Shaper M1980
- (2) Acer E-Mill M3VK Vertical Miller - Servo Power Feed - Newall DRO Topaz 2-Axis
- Royal MS-24B Heavy Duty Geared Head Drilling & Tapping
- Progressive Drill M4E Heavy-Duty Gear Head Drill (Keyway)
Other Machinery
- Sunnen MBB-1660 Automatic Honing
- Chenlong CNC Band Saw, 16" Cap.
- Wells MW-9 Twin-Post Band Saw
- Mini-Broach M3A Horizontal Broaching
- Trinco Dry-Blast M36/450
- Mr Deburr Tumbler
- Annealing Oven 1200 DEG
- J&S M540 Surface Grinder - 6" x 18"
- Starrett HE400 10" Comparator
- Mitutoyo LH600 Linear Height Gage
- Drill Press - Various
- Misc. Deburring Equipment & Machines
